By far the most frequent way Bet9ja accounts are compromised is not through hacking Bet9ja’s servers, but through directed at users. Attackers create fake websites that look nearly identical to the Bet9ja old mobile login page, then lure victims via text messages, WhatsApp links, or emails promising bonuses or requiring immediate “account verification.” When the user enters their username and password on the fake site, the attacker captures those credentials and uses them to take over the real account. bet9ja old mobile log in safety analysis full

The older data-saving protocols do not always enforce strict HTTP Strict Transport Security (HSTS). If a user logs into the old mobile site via an unsecured public Wi-Fi network, they face a higher risk of man-in-the-middle (MITM) attacks compared to using the official updated mobile application.
